Progress to Phase II … WebSubacromial decompression surgery smooths down the surface of your acromion so it doesn’t rub against your tendons. This helps to ease your pain. Preparing for subacromial decompression. Your operation will be done by an orthopaedic surgeon (a doctor who specialises in bone surgery). They’ll explain how to prepare for your procedure. WebSLAP tear surgery, or arthroscopic SLAP tear surgery, is often done to repair damaged shoulder cartilage, called a SLAP tear. SLAP stands for S uperior L abrum, A nterior to P osterior. The L in SLAP refers to your glenoid labrum. Your labrum cushions the top part of your upper arm bone, or humerus. This cushion helps your upper arm bone stay ... It takes six to eight weeks for the tendon to heal to the bone. Complete recovery time varies by size of the tear. For a small tears, full recovery time is about four months, for large tears, six months. For severe, massive tears, a complete recovery can take anywhere from 6 to 12 months.

It is important to start physical therapy within a few days after surgery (if not the next day). It is suggested to continue therapy three times per week, with supplemental home exercise program to progress ROM when not in supervised physical therapy.
